Medivir AB announced that a poster entitled A triple combination of fostrox (MIV-818) with immune checkpoint and kinase inhibition shows increased anti-tumor efficacy in vivo, will be presented at the American Association for Cancer Research (AACR) Annual Meeting by Fredrik Öberg, CSO at Medivir. Fostroxacitabine bralpamide (fostrox) is an orally administered liver targeted prodrug currently undergoing a phase 1/2a clinical study in advanced hepatocellular carcinoma (HCC), in combination with Keytruda® (anti-PD1) or Lenvima® (kinase inhibitor) (NCT0341818). In previous studies, Fostrox has shown significantly increased anti-tumor effect in combination with both anti-PD1 and kinase inhibitors in non-clinical tumor models, which opens the door for a potentially further enhanced tumor effect with a triple combination.

The poster supports this potential as it exhibits that fostrox combined with both anti-PD1 and Lenvima® shows a synergistic anti-tumor effect in a non-clinical tumor model characterized by the same low, underlying DNA damage seen in patients with HCC. The poster also shows that fostrox induces increased tumor infiltration of CD8+ T cells as well as increased expression of PD-L1 and LAG-3, indicating increased immune-mediated antitumor activity. The results indicate a potential for triple combination of anti-PD1 and Lenvima® with fostrox in the treatment of HCC.
